A man in his 30s was found shot to death inside a vehicle early Sunday in Los Angeles’ Westlake neighborhood, and a woman who had been at the same party was wounded and later taken to a hospital, authorities said.

Officers were sent around 4 a.m. to the area of Sixth and Witmer streets, where they discovered the man inside a vehicle with gunshot wounds, according to MyNewsLA. He was pronounced dead at the scene.

The Los Angeles Police Department’s Media Relations Section told MyNewsLA that the shooting followed an altercation at a nearby party, where “one person produced a gun and opened fire.” The woman injured in the incident took herself to a hospital and was reported to have stable vital signs. Police did not immediately provide a suspect description.

Investigation

LAPD Media Relations has not yet released the victim’s name, a possible motive, or any information about arrests. Additional details were not available at the time of publication, according to MyNewsLA.
